description Childhood obesity is one of the nutritional problems with increasing numbers nationwide, related to the availability and proximity of foods high in fat and sugar such as those found at children's parties. There is a need to improve eating habits in boys and girls, as well as to have healthy options on the market aimed at children's parties. The objective of the research was to know the commercial opportunity for healthy snacks at children's parties, considering consumption characteristics, distribution channels and importance of the value proposition. The sample was 97 parents with children under 12 years, belonging to districts that house the highest percentage of families with socioeconomic levels A and B, to whom a 21-question survey was applied virtually through Google Forms. 100 % of parents indicated that they would be willing to buy healthy snacks for children's parties, 95 % choosing social networks and the website as the main distribution channel, 95.9 % preferred delivery service and 90.7 % valued the use of eco-friendly packaging. The average they would pay for healthy snacks is S/ 565.77 and the value for mode was S/ 500. The preferred payment methods were transfer and credit card. The results reveal an important commercial opportunity related to the interest of respondents in having healthy snack options at children's parties following current purchasing, delivery and environmental care trends.
